5 Must-Have Home Security Devices For Your Home

Home security protection is now an affordable solution for
everyone. Not only does your home need protection, more
importantly, your family does as well. Nothing is worse than
your home being robbed while you are away, except perhaps for
it to be burglarized when you are in the house. Protecting your
home from burglars can be done effectively if you install the
right equipment. There is a huge array of reliable and
relatively inexpensive security devices that you can have
installed, but exactly what you want to install depends on your
budget and specific requirements. The general rule is: the more
secure, the better.
Of the many types of security devices available, and there are
many, the following five should definitely be at the top of
your list.
1) Home security and management system
This ultramodern security system is the best solution to ensure
that your home is safe, both when you're away and when you're in
the house. This system allows you to not only secure the entire
house, but also to secure individual zones within the house,
such as separate floors or garage. Coupled to a number of
motion sensors, you can set passwords to activate and
de-activate the system.
2) Secure doors and windows
Another must is to ensure that all your doors and windows are
secure. Use strong and sufficient locks. Doors and windows can
be fitted with additional security devices such as sensors and
alarms that sound when they're forced open or the glass is
broken.
3) Digital video security cameras
A Closed Circuit Television (CCTV) system allows you to keep an
overview of everything that's happening around your home.
Especially if you have a large home with extra land, this
system will help you to keep an eye on your whole property
including vulnerable, dark, tucked-away corners. The security
cameras used don't have to be large, eye-catching devices,
although many people prefer these for their deterrent
properties. The most modern digital cameras are not much larger
than a mobile phone and can take both videos and snapshot
pictures. One or more home security monitors showing live
images can be placed anywhere in the house and you can record
the images for replaying and reviewing later.
4) Motion sensor lights
By placing a number of motion sensor lights around your house
and yard, you will greatly enhance the security of your
property as well as your peace of mind. Automatically activated
lights will scare away any unwanted visitors trying to enter
your grounds, while at the same time they can alert any
neighbors to suspicious activity.
5) Mace and pepper spray
Although this is a personal safety device, it should form part
of your security package. Mace or pepper spray is highly
effective to deter attackers, both out on the street and in
your home. If the unthinkable happens despite your best efforts
and someone manages to get into your home, a well-aimed shot of
mace or pepper spray will do the trick and give you time to
alert the police.
These five home security devices will provide ample protection
for the average home. The main objective of a security system
is to deter potential burglars. Home security systems should be
installed not in the hopes that it will be used but rather for
preventative measures.
